Cozy Leftover Casserole (Print Version)

# Ingredients:

01 - 1 cup of corn kernels.
02 - 1 1/2 cups of shredded turkey meat.
03 - 2 tablespoons of milk.
04 - 1 cup of turkey gravy.
05 - 2 cups of mashed potatoes.
06 - 3/4 cup of cranberry sauce.
07 - 2 cups of stuffing mix.
08 - A bit of melted butter or chicken broth, depending on your preference.

# Instructions:

01 - Set your oven to 400°F (200°C) and let it heat up.
02 - Mix the turkey with cranberry sauce, then spread it evenly in an 8x8 glass pan.
03 - Spread mashed potatoes across the turkey mixture, smoothing it out evenly.
04 - Scatter the corn over the mashed potato layer.
05 - Stir together the milk and gravy, then pour it over the corn and potatoes.
06 - Spread an even layer of stuffing over the top.
07 - Lightly drizzle some broth or butter on top to make sure the stuffing doesn't dry out.
08 - Cover the dish with foil and bake for 25-30 minutes, until everything is hot and bubbly.
09 - Enjoy it warm and fresh from the oven!

# Notes:

01 - Make it your own! Swap out potatoes for rice, or toss in leftover veggies like carrots or peas.
02 - No stuffing on hand? Use breadcrumbs or croutons to create a crunchy topping.
